Kommandozeilen-Verarbeitung

Sie haben gesehen, wie die Shell read verwendet, um Eingabezeilen zu bearbeiten: sie kümmert sich um einfache (' ') und doppelte Anführungszeichen (»«) und um Backslashes (\), trennt Zeilen in einzelne Wörter auf, je nach Trennzeichen in der Umgebungsvariablen IFS, und sie weist diese Wörter an Shell-Variablen zu. Diesen Vorgang können Sie sich als Untermenge all dessen vorstellen, was die Shell macht, wenn sie Kommandozeilen verarbeitet.

Das Thema Kommandozeilen-Verarbeitung wurde an vielen Stellen in diesem Buch angeschnitten. Nun ist der richtige Moment, das alles ganz deutlich zu machen. Jede Zeile, die von der Shell aus der Standardeingabe oder einem Skript gelesen wird, heißt eine Pipeline; Sie enthält ein oder ...

Get Einführung in die bash-Shell now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.